Choosing the Right Milwaukee Power Tool: Key Criteria
For plumbers, the decision to buy a Milwaukee power tool should be driven by specific criteria tailored to their daily tasks. First, power and torque are fundamental. A tool like the Milwaukee M18 FUEL drill/driver provides up to 550 inch-lbs of torque, enabling it to handle dense materials like concrete and steel pipes with ease. The brushless motors in Milwaukee tools also increase efficiency and lifespan, making them a cost-effective investment.
Size and weight are equally important. Compact tools such as the Milwaukee M18COMPACT BRUSHLESS 1/2 INCH Hammer Drill weigh just over 3 pounds, reducing user fatigue when working overhead or in tight spaces. Battery life is another crucial element—high-capacity batteries like Milwaukee’s REDLITHIUM CP2.0 provide longer runtimes, minimizing interruptions and boosting productivity.
Versatility is enhanced through combo kits, which include multiple tools designed for different tasks—drilling, impact driving, cutting, and grinding. These kits often come with multiple batteries and storage solutions, streamlining your workflow. Safety features, such as AutoStop or LED lights, improve visibility and prevent accidents, especially in poorly lit or cluttered environments.
Finally, durability factors, like all-metal gear cases and sealed motors, ensure the tools withstand harsh conditions typical of plumbing work. By focusing on these criteria, you can select Milwaukee tools that are not only powerful but also reliable and tailored to your specific job requirements.
FAQs about Milwaukee Plumbing Power Tools
Q: Are Milwaukee power tools suitable for heavy-duty plumbing jobs?
A: Yes, especially models like the Milwaukee 2903-20 M18 FUEL drill/driver, which delivers high torque and advanced safety features suitable for dense materials and demanding tasks.
Q: Do I need special batteries for Milwaukee tools?
A: Milwaukee’s tools typically use standard M18 lithium-ion batteries, with high-capacity options like 5.0 Ah or 8.0 Ah, providing extended runtime. Batteries are usually sold separately or included in kits.
Q: Can Milwaukee tools work in tight spaces?
A: Absolutely. Compact models like the M18COMPACT BRUSHLESS drill are designed for overhead applications and confined areas, making them ideal for plumbing installations in tight spaces.
Q: Are combo kits worth the investment for plumbers?
A: Yes, especially if you need multiple tools such as drills, impact drivers, and saws. They offer great value, include batteries and chargers, and ensure you’re prepared for various tasks.
Q: How durable are Milwaukee tools for daily plumbing use?
A: Milwaukee tools are built with durable materials like all-metal gear cases and sealed motors, designed to withstand the rigors of daily professional use in demanding environments.
